English: PRESIDENT BUSH ARRIVES THE DOWNTOWN MANHATTAN HELIPORT ABOARD MARINE ONE. HE IS ACCOMPANIED BY GOV. GEORGE PATAKI AND MAYOR RUDOLPH GIULIANI. THE PRESIDENT VISITS THE SITE OF THE WORLD TRADE CENTER DISASTER. HE GREETS FIREFIGHTERS, POLICE AND RESCUE PERSONNEL. THE PRESIDENT IS ACCOMPANIED BY NEW YORK FIRE DEPARTMENT COMMISSIONER THOMAS VON ESSEN, SEN. CHARLES (CHUCK) SCHUMER, SEN. HILLARY RODHAM CLINTON, REP. CHARLES (CHARLIE) RANGEL, FEMA DIRECTOR JOE ALLBAUGH, ANDY CARD, ARI FLEISCHER AND OTHERS. FORMER NYC MAYOR ED KOCH IS PRESENT. THE PRESIDENT USES A BULLHORN TO ADDRESS THE RESCUE WORKERS. HE PUTS HIS ARM AROUND RETIRED FIREMAN BOB BECKWITH FROM LADDER 117. HE WAVES THE AMERICAN FLAG (RELEASE, JUMBO P7376-22 IS ALSO A WHITE HOUSE WEB SITE PHOTO). RESCUE WORKERS CHEER THE PRESIDENT (JUMBO, P7377-6 IS A WH WEB SITE PHOTO). TWO FIREMEN STAND AT GROUND ZERO (JUMBO P7377-13). THE PRESIDENT TOURS THE MURRAY STREET AND WEST STREET DISASTER SITE. HE VISITS WITH FAMILIES OF MISSING AND DECEASED EMERGENCY SERVICE WORKERS. HE GREETS FEMA AND RESCUE VOLUNTEERS AT THE JACOB K. JAVITS CONVENTION CENTER. ARLENE HOWARD PRESENTS THE PRESIDENT WITH HER SON'S POLICE BADGE (RELEASE P7385-16). PORT AUTHORITY POLICE OFFICER GEORGE HOWARD WAS WEARING THE BADGE WHEN HE WAS KILLED. PRESIDENT BUSH PUTS HIS ARMS AROUND AN UNIDENTIFIED COUPLE (JUMBO, RELEASE AND WH WEB SITE PHOTO P7385-12). THE PRESIDENT AUTOGRAPHS A BANNER. HE IS GIVEN AN AMERICAN FLAG AND A TEXAS STATE FLAG. PRESIDENT BUSH DEPARTS NEW YORK CITY ABOARD MARINE ONE. HE LOOKS DOWN AT THE NIGHTTIME RESCUE SITE.
